Among the top picks is the Tiny Land 7-in-1 Pikler Triangle Set, which features a foldable design, FSC-certified wood, and a reversible ramp, supporting children aged 2 to 10. Priced at $170, it combines durability with eco-friendly packaging and carbon-neutral shipping. Piccalio’s Climber Pikler Triangle offers a foldable, portable option for children from 6 months to 6 years, made from FSC birch plywood and New Zealand pine, with a price tag of $349. It includes a reversible ramp with a rock wall, promoting climbing and balancing activities. Another notable option is Bunny Hopkins’ American-made Climbing Triangle, crafted from sustainable maple wood and available in two sizes for toddlers through kindergarteners, with prices ranging from $249 to $729. 01 · Why It Matters

Eco-Friendly Pikler Triangles & Child Development

Choosing non-toxic, sustainably made Pikler triangles ensures a safer play environment and reduces exposure to harmful chemicals. Originally developed by Dr. Emmi Pikler to promote motor skills, these climbers build confidence, balance and independent play during the most crucial early-childhood years — while durable, ethically produced toys align with values of environmental responsibility and social fairness.

MOTOR SKILLS

Gross & Fine Movement

Climbing, pulling up and balancing on rungs develops coordination, grip strength and body awareness from around 6 months onward.

INDEPENDENT PLAY

Child-Led Exploration

The open-ended design lets children set their own challenges, fostering confidence and self-directed learning without adult intervention.

SAFETY & MATERIALS

Non-Toxic by Design

FSC-certified birch, maple and pine with finishes free from VOCs and phthalates — plus rounded edges and stable construction.

Key Questions

Are Pikler triangles suitable for all ages of toddlers?

Most Pikler triangles are designed for children from around 6 months to 5 or 6 years old, but age recommendations vary by product. Always check the manufacturer’s guidelines to ensure safety and suitability for your child’s age and size.

What materials are used in these Pikler sets?

All listed sets are made from sustainably sourced, non-toxic woods such as FSC-certified birch, maple, or pine, with finishes that are free from VOCs, phthalates, and other harmful chemicals. Some include eco-friendly plywood and water-based stains.

How do I know if a Pikler triangle is safe for my child?

Look for products with certifications like FSC, Greenguard, or similar safety standards. Ensure the set has rounded edges, non-toxic finishes, stable construction, and is appropriate for your child’s age and weight.

Can these products be passed down or used long-term?

Yes, most high-quality Pikler triangles are built to last with durable wood and sturdy construction, making them suitable for passing down or long-term use as children grow.
